Relevance:Inhibitor of bone morphogenetic proteins (BMP) signaling which is required for growth and patterning of the neural tube and somite. Essential for cartilage morphogenesis and joint formation. Inhibits chondrocyte differentiation throµgh its interaction with GDF5 (PubMed:21976273). {ECO:0000269|PubMed:12478285, ECO:0000269|PubMed:21976273}.

Function:Inhibitor of bone morphogenetic proteins (BMP) signaling which is required for growth and patterning of the neural tube and somite. Essential for cartilage morphogenesis and joint formation. Inhibits chondrocyte differentiation throµgh its interaction with GDF5 and, probably, GDF6
Involvement in disease:Symphalangism, proximal 1A (SYM1A); MµLtiple synostoses syndrome 1 (SYNS1); Tarsal-carpal coalition syndrome (TCC); Stapes ankylosis with broad thumb and toes (SABTS); Brachydactyly B2 (BDB2)
